Carbon Nanotubes: Unveiling a World of Possibilities at the Nanoscale

Carbon nanotubes (CNTs), a class of nanomaterials with remarkable mechanical, electrical, and thermal properties, have captured the imagination of researchers and innovators across diverse fields. Discovered in 1991, these cylindrical structures composed of carbon atoms have demonstrated a range of unique benefits that hold the potential to revolutionize industries and technologies. From advanced materials to biomedical applications, the advantages of carbon nanotubes are paving the way for a new era of innovation and discovery.

Exceptional Mechanical Strength: Carbon nanotubes possess extraordinary mechanical strength, making them some of the strongest materials known to humanity. Their tensile strength exceeds that of steel while being much lighter. Superior Thermal Conductivity: CNTs also exhibit excellent thermal conductivity, outperforming most traditional materials. This property makes them invaluable for thermal administration applications, such as heat bowls in microelectronic devices and even as fillers in materials used for efficient heat dissipation.

Electrical Conductivity: Carbon nanotubes can conduct electricity with remarkable efficiency. This property has led to their integration into electronics, where they can be used as components in transistors, interconnects, and sensors. Energy Storage: Carbon nanotubes show potential for energy storage applications. When used in supercapacitors, CNTs can store and release electrical energy rapidly, offering higher power densities compared to traditional batteries. Additionally, CNTs can be incorporated into battery electrodes, leading to improved energy storage capacity.

Flexible and Transparent Conductors: The combination of electrical conductivity and flexibility makes carbon nanotubes suitable for applications requiring transparent conductors. CNT films can be used in flexible electronics, touch screens, and solar cells as alternatives to traditional materials like indium tin oxide (ITO). These films are not only highly conductive but also maintain their properties even when bent or stretched.

Water Filtration and Desalination: Carbon nanotubes have shown promise in water filtration and desalination processes. Their nanoscale dimensions and hydrophobic properties make them effective in removing contaminants and froths from water. CNT-based membranes could potentially revolutionize water treatment, offering a more efficient and sustainable approach to clean water production.

Biomedical Applications: In the field of medicine, carbon nanotubes have demonstrated significant potential. They can be functionalized with biomolecules for targeted drug delivery, allowing for precise and controlled release of medications. CNTs are also being explored for use in imaging, tissue engineering, and biosensors, revolutionizing diagnostics and therapies.

Lightweight and Strong Materials: The combination of exceptional strength and low weight makes carbon nanotubes ideal for creating lightweight and durable materials. They have been used in the development of advanced composites for aerospace, automotive, and construction industries. Nanoelectromechanical Systems (NEMS): Carbon nanotubes play a vital role in the emerging field of nanoelectromechanical systems. Due to their small size and mechanical properties, CNTs can be used as resonators, switches, and sensors in extremely tiny devices with applications in communication, sensing, and medical diagnostics.

Environmental Remediation: Carbon nanotubes have demonstrated effectiveness in environmental remediation. They can adsorb heavy metals and pollutants from water and soil, providing a promising avenue for addressing environmental contamination issues.

Space Exploration: The lightweight and strong nature of carbon nanotubes makes them attractive for space applications. They have been considered for use in lightweight and strong structural components, such as space elevators, which could revolutionize space travel.

In conclusion, the benefits of carbon nanotubes are extensive and far-reaching, touching upon a multitude of industries and applications. From revolutionizing materials science and electronics to enabling breakthroughs in medicine and environmental sustainability, these remarkable nanomaterials continue to inspire researchers and innovators around the world. While challenges such as scalability, cost, and safety need to be addressed, the potential for carbon nanotubes to reshape technology and improve quality of life is undeniable.
